display inactive users

This commit is contained in:
Charles 2025-08-29 08:53:00 +02:00
parent 245f044a40
commit 1e33782f75
2 changed files with 2 additions and 4 deletions

View File

@ -43,7 +43,7 @@ class UserController extends AbstractController
if ($this->isGranted('ROLE_SUPER_ADMIN')) {
$uo = $this->entityManager->getRepository(UsersOrganizations::class)->findUsersWithOrganization();
$noOrgUsers = $this->userService->formatNoOrgUsersAsAssoc(
$this->entityManager->getRepository(User::class)->findActiveUsersWithoutOrganization());
$this->entityManager->getRepository(User::class)->findUsersWithoutOrganization());
$usersByOrganization = $this->userService->groupByOrganization($uo);
$usersByOrganization += $noOrgUsers;

View File

@ -40,16 +40,14 @@ class UserRepository extends ServiceEntityRepository implements PasswordUpgrader
*
* @return User[]
*/
public function findActiveUsersWithoutOrganization(): array
public function findUsersWithoutOrganization(): array
{
$qb = $this->createQueryBuilder('u')
->select('u')
->leftJoin(UsersOrganizations::class, 'uo', 'WITH', 'uo.users = u')
->where('u.isActive = :uActive')
->andWhere('u.isDeleted = :uDeleted')
->andWhere('uo.id IS NULL')
->orderBy('u.surname', 'ASC')
->setParameter('uActive', true)
->setParameter('uDeleted', false);
return $qb->getQuery()->getResult();